The number can remain 1 as it uses the variable to count. Right click the new graphic element variable and select model parameter. Both are from the model dropdown menu in the model builder window. This tutorial illustrates some of the pertinent considerations, such as no spaces in field names, when importing data into arcgis as well as how to use modelbuilder to plan and automate tasks. This tool is only intended for use when building models. While a model will typically not compute with invalid pipe length or diameter data, importing a model with this information through modelbuilder can be allowed.
I am able to create new models and i can edit other models ive built, just not this. Hosted by esri at create a personal login if needed. Learn how to use model builder and python, inside arcgis and qgis, to automate geoprocessing and write simple python scripts. Sep 27, 2015 model builder iterators video one iterate through features duration. The processes in the model and the relations between them are dynamic so whenever a change is made the model is dynamically updated.
Models are workflows that string together sequences of geoprocessing tools, feeding the output of one tool into another tool as input. Inout derived data is the result of a tool that alters the input data rather than creates a new dataset, such as the add field tool. Modelbuilder for automating tasks and using arcgis with r. Modelbuilder, along with scripting, is a way for you to integrate arcgis with other applications. Using modelbuilder and customizing the arcmap interface toolboxes can be created in arctoolbox, in folders or within geodatabases. Creating tools with modelbuilder this tutorial takes you stepbystep through the process of creating a model tool. Model builder is a visual modeling tool that allows you to build workflows and scripts. While modelbuilder is very useful for constructing and. Click the start modelbuilder tool found on the standard toolbar in arcmap, arccatalog, arcglobe, or arcscene. This course is for students who have experience with gis and would like to take it to the next level. I opened a new modelbuilder session and set the model properties to current and scratch databases to make the elevation raster easier to read and manipulate, i utilized the mosaic to new raster tool to combine the raster files with the following parameters figure 3 i then used the hillshade tool to make the terrain described by. In this exercise, you will create a model that summarizes the area of different soil names and forest age classes within a constant width road buffer. Tools you create with modelbuilder can be used in python scripting and other models.
Rightclick on the output and choose model parameter. Model input study area region clip model tool dialog model parameter model parameters on model tool dialog. Geoprocessing tools can be accessed in arcgis via arctoolbox, modelbuilder, or. Calculate geometry in model builder geonet, the esri. Considering that your interest is only about the cons, ill let the benefits out and try to list as you asked. Geoprocessing with model builder geoprocessing is the processing of geographic information. The figure at right shows an example model that clips soils data. A user friendly gis model for the estimation of erosion.
Basically, i just need to know how to calculate geometry in model builder. If an iterator is added to a model, all tools in the model iterate for each value in the iterator. The procedure below outlines the steps necessary to create a simple model, save the. Rsgis quick start guides geospatial innovation facility.
Pdf arcgis modelbuilder applications for landscape. This guide provides a generic example of using modelbuilder to create feature classes to assist beginners with. For this lab you will use model builder to geoprocess spatial data. In this exercise, you will create a model that summarizes the area of different soil names and forest age classes within a constant width road buffer click the model builder window icon from the menu bar. When you build models, the output from some tools can be a folder, geodatabase, feature dataset, or coverage into which results are placed, such as feature classes or tables. Students learn how to create the process that easily updates their crime database and maps new crimes using arcgis at the click of just 3 buttons. However its unclear from your question if this is really what youre trying to do, because you mention related tables, which is a whole different story and typically implies a onetomany relationship which you cant domake permanent without duplicating features. You can open modelbuilder by creating a new model or editing an existing model. Documents and settingsadministradormis documentosarcgisdefault. This is a blm geospatial learning pathways presentation. In arcmap version 10, you only need to click on the modelbuilder window icon from the menu bar, and you can open the model builder.
In this tutorial, well use modelbuilder to create a buffer around a feature and use that buffer to clip another feature. You can create something like a flowchart on a modelbuilder canvas, with placeholders for data, connected by operations, and resulting in some output. In the modelbuilder window, from the model menu, choose model properties. Models can be saved to a toolbox for reuse, and can be executed as needed. A user friendly gis model for the estimation of erosion risk. You can replace the join table export result to new file workflow with the join field tool. Mar 23, 2016 accessible from either arcmap or arccatalog, modelbuilder allows you to combine a series of geoprocessing tools in a flowchartstyle visual model in order to streamline iterative mapping processes. Geoprocessing is an essential aspect of gis that provides the ability to analyze and process geographic data. Automating gis using model builder and python scripts using. Modelbuilder can also be thought of as a visual programming language for building workflows. Modelbuilder applications for landscape development planning in the munich region 49 fig. To access this data so it can be used in future processing in the model, you can use the select data tool to extract the data you want to use.
Click the general tab and type cave groundwater protection model in both the name and label. Rightclick the newly created variable and select model parameter. The input to the select data tool can be referred to as the parent, since it may contain other datasets, such as tables or feature classes. Sep 26, 2015 an introduction on how to use the model builder tool in arcgis and how to deconstruct problems in order to model them. Model builder iterators video one iterate through features duration. In the dialog that comes up, choose the iteration tab at the top, and set the get the iteration count from this variable to bio1, or whatever the name of your input layer variable is. Validate your model, then save the model as a new model execute the model from arccatalog and you now see a more universal buff tool with a wizard asking the many questions necessary to successfully run the program.
There are actually two kinds of derived data that you should be aware of. In the general tab, rename the model label select by attribute 6. End users can also create new maps in just 5 minutes using this process. Modelbuilder is an application you use to create, edit, and manage models. The model is made up of spatial analyst tools, the extension for which ive enabled. A new model is added to the toolbox and is opened in the modelbuilder window. The model parameter will show the selected table or database connection. Model environmentsdiscusses the use of geoprocessing environment variables and how they can be used in models. Accessible from either arcmap or arccatalog, modelbuilder allows you to combine a series of geoprocessing tools in a flowchartstyle visual model in order to streamline iterative mapping processes. If you do not want to run each tool in the model for each iterated value, create a submodelmodel within a model that contains only the iterator and add. If you are ok with the original projection of the feature class, at 10 i believe if you choose the python 9.
Modelbuilder tools and iterators models in the arcgis environment are used to automate geoprocessing workflows, and are often used to perform repetitive tasks. Model appearanceshows how you can change the look and arrangement of model elements to increase readability. To rename a model, you edit the label in the model properties dialog box. I will likely encounter a variety of formatting, labeling, and quality differences among datasets so standardizing the process would be beneficial. If you do not want to run each tool in the model for each iterated value, create a submodelmodel within a model that contains only the iterator and add it as a model tool into the main model. In this tutorial, the model built in the executing tools in modelbuilder tutorial is made into a useful tool by exposing model variables as model parameters for a broad overview of creating model tools, see a quick tour of creating tools with modelbuilder it is assumed that you have installed arcgis for. Youll see an overview of the modelbuilder menu toolbar and a software demonstration on how to build a model. Click the modelbuilder button on the analysis ribbon tab to create a new model in the project toolbox. Rightclick an existing toolbox or toolset in the catalog pane and choose new model. Show help output feature class east east output feature class west west cancei environments indiana department of environmental management a nni protecting hoosiers and our environment since 1986 a state that works. Creating simple models using model builder 4 of 5 to give us a better view of what the model is doing, lets give the user the chance to change the output file name.
In the arctoolbox window, rightclick an existing model and choose edit. I cant seem to locate the function in standalone format to drag in to model builder, and assume there is another approach, most likely a simple one. Modelbuilder is an easytouse application for creating and running workflows containing a sequence of tools. In the modelbuilder window, choose model model properties from the menu bar. If youve closed your model builder dialogue, you can rightclick on the model and choose edit to bring the window back. I tried using select by location tool but for some reason it wont connect to my sde, the only type it wants to connect to is data element. For a broad overview of creating model tools, see a quick tour of creating tools with modelbuilder. Modelbuilder is a visual programming language for building geoprocessing workflows. You can create a model using one of the following techniques. Doubleclick the model parameter and navigate to database connections. You create and modify geoprocessing models in modelbuilder, where a model is represented as a diagram that chains together sequences of processes and geoprocessing.
An introduction on how to use the model builder tool in arcgis and how to deconstruct problems in order to model them. A custom toolbox is a toolbox to which you have write access. In this tutorial, the model built in the executing tools in modelbuilder tutorial is made into a useful tool by exposing model variables as model parameters. In the arctoolbox window, rightclick a custom toolbox, point to new, and choose model. Ive just started learning about modelbuilder in arcgis and i think it could really be usefull in what i am doing, the problem is i cant quite figure out what tools to use. In this tutorial you will place the toolbox in your project folder.
Model builder tutorial automating suitability analysis. If you are syncing the model out to update a source file, this issue can occur if the geometry of the pipes in the model is such that the length is zero. Role model builder building an ideal representation why we need model builder. Automating gis using model builder and python scripts using arcgis and qgis. Models are created in arcgis desktop 10 using the modelbuilder window. This tutorial takes you stepbystep through the process of creating a model tool. The resulting map is an interactive pdf that allows the end user to turn on and off layers within the map without any special software. If you do not have a custom toolbox, you can easily create one by rightclicking in the arctoolbox window and clicking new toolbox. Im trying to edit a model that i created yet the modelbuilder window doesnt open when i rightclick and edit, which worked before today. Geographic information systems stack exchange is a question and answer site for cartographers, geographers and gis professionals.
To access this data so it can be used in future processing in the model, you can use the select data tool to. Feb 10, 2014 considering that your interest is only about the cons, ill let the benefits out and try to list as you asked. The benefits of modelbuilder can be summarized as follows. The main advantage of using the arcgis model builder for the application of usle and the assessment of soil erosion risk for the study area was the automation of a spatial analytical procedure. Your presenter is shelley johnson of the montana state office. It is one of the fundamental functions of a geographic information system. Customized dialog box of the final suitab ility model with explanations about its purpose and. Rightclick cave tutorial tools and choose new model. The create table tool creates new data that will be written to disk when you execute the model. Modelbuilder automate processing modelbuilder is an arcmap application that you can use to create processing workflows and tools. Printing a model, generate and print a report model reporting, and export a model to a script exporting a model. Geoprocessing tools can be accessed in arcgis via arctoolbox, modelbuilder, or python scripts.
Jul 04, 20 what i want to do is use model builder to select by location so all features within the boundary plus a 2 mile buffer are selected. Automating gis using model builder and python scripts. Geoprocessing models automate and document your spatial analysis and data management processes. Introduction to arcgis modelbuilder is presented by the montana state office. Using modelbuilder to create feature classes models are workflows that can be created in arcgis to automate geoprocessing tasks, and can be saved to arctoolbox and executed as necessary.